We are seeking an experienced Combined Cycle Power Plant Control Room Operator who is eager to work as part of a Team at our Arlington Valley Facility!

Reporting to the Operations Manager, as the Control Room Operator, you will work as the lead of a three-person team on a 12-hour rotating shift, responsible for the safe and efficient operation of a 580MW Combined Cycle Power Plant from the Control Room utilizing various control systems, as well as directing the operation of all plant equipment.

The Operator must be able to work with others and assist in Overtime for other shifts as required.

You will contribute to our team by:
  • Ensure the safe and reliable operation of all plant equipment across varying conditions, including Gas and Steam Turbines, Generators, HRSGs, emissions monitoring, electrical systems, and all auxiliary balance-of-plant equipment, using Turbine Control and Distributed Control Systems.
  • Responsible for operating and monitoring plant equipment remotely, using control systems, and instrumentation, while tracking key parameters (temperature, pressure, levels, vibration, water chemistry) and reviewing operator rounds to verify performance and identify trends.
  • Issuing permits, including but not limited to Lockout/Tagout, Confined Space, and Hot Work as required to authorize work.
  • Utilizing the Computerized Maintenance Management System to enter service requests, as well as documenting the performance of assigned Preventative Maintenance.
  • Communicating plant conditions, particularly when unusual or abnormal, to the Operations Manager and Lead Control Room Operator.
  • Assisting with development of operations procedures and programs.
  • Performing general housekeeping and continuous improvement of the appearance of the facility as required.
  • Assisting with junior operator training.
  • Strictly adhering to all safety and environmental rules and regulations to protect employees, contractors, community, and the environment.
  • Operating heavy equipment such as a man-lift and forklift as required.
  • Assisting with performing Root Cause Analysis of failures as required.
What you will bring to the role:
Education
  • Completed High School Diploma required.
  • Technical training related to the role is preferred.
Experience and Skills
  • Experience as a Control Room Operator for Combined Cycle Plants is highly desirable. Preferably with GE 7FA combustion turbines and GE D11 steam turbines.
  • Experience with GE Mark VIe turbine control system and DeltaV balance of plant control system also preferred
  • Extensive working knowledge of the power plant industry is desirable.
  • Experience as an Operator in a power plant is desired.
  • Theoretical and practical knowledge of combustion/steam turbine operations closed system steam generation, industrial safety, hazardous waste management and inspection/recording of plant parameters is highly desirable.
  • Experience with piping and instrument schematics and process control is desirable.
Technical Skills
  • Solid ability to solve equipment, systems, and safety issues.
  • Gas Power Plant Operation and Maintenance experience.
  • Able to problem solve and troubleshoot at an expert level concerning operating issues at Gas Power Plant.
  • Must be able to communicate effectively with co-workers and help foster a positive team environment.
Working Conditions
  • Heavy industrial facility designated as a safety-sensitive location.
  • Physical mobility, including lifting and climbing, and ability to use PPE required.
  • Rotating Shift Work required.
  • Primarily working independently in Control Room but outside work as necessary during maintenance activities
